The Solid Fuels Desk is responsible for global coal, freight and biomass trading, including sourcing of steam coal and biomass for the RWE coal generation assets in the UK and continental Europe. The Freight Logistics team manages physical dry bulk vessel charter contracts and acts as the main contact for operational matters.
The role aims to optimize fleet efficiency through voyage data analysis, performance assessment, and negotiating claims. It includes monitoring fuel consumption, speed, hull efficiency, and supporting contract performance to contribute to the Dry Bulk Freight Trading desk.
* Data Analysis and Reporting: analyze voyage data, fuel consumption, speed, and other metrics to assess vessel performance
* Review, interpret, and apply contract clauses to statements of account and performance claims
* Prepare and negotiate methodologies with counterparties for performance deductions
* Liaise with legal and P&I Club on unresolved claims
* Evaluate vessel performance against criteria like fuel efficiency, voyage duration, and emissions
* Identify deviations, recommend corrective actions, review fuel consumption, compare vessels, and manage hull fouling
* Resolve claims and disputes efficiently
* Assist chartering and operations with performance feedback and solutions
* Provide accurate vessel performance data to the trading desk
* Support automation of performance claims process
Qualifications:
* Degree or apprenticeship
* Background in Marine Engineering or Naval Architecture, with relevant experience
* Experience creating and defending vessel speed and consumption claims
* Knowledge of vessel operations, propulsion, and maritime tech
* Detail-oriented, analytical, and proficient in data tools
* Fluent in English
